Skip to content

Commit e426142

Browse files
committed
Fix building without tests
1 parent 01025f8 commit e426142

File tree

1 file changed

+6
-4
lines changed

1 file changed

+6
-4
lines changed

src/global/test/CMakeLists.txt

Lines changed: 6 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-10,7 +10,9 @@ set(MODULE_TEST_SRC
1010

1111
include(${PROJECT_SOURCE_DIR}/build/module_test.cmake)
1212

13-
set(TARGET ${MODULE}_test)
14-
target_link_libraries(${TARGET} cmake_git_version_tracking)
15-
string(TIMESTAMP BUILD_YEAR "%Y")
16-
target_compile_definitions(${TARGET} PRIVATE BUILD_YEAR=${BUILD_YEAR})
13+
if (SCRATCHCPP_PLAYER_BUILD_UNIT_TESTS)
14+
set(TARGET ${MODULE}_test)
15+
target_link_libraries(${TARGET} cmake_git_version_tracking)
16+
string(TIMESTAMP BUILD_YEAR "%Y")
17+
target_compile_definitions(${TARGET} PRIVATE BUILD_YEAR=${BUILD_YEAR})
18+
endif()

0 commit comments

Comments
 (0)